Aswani,

The landscape of football in Senegal has changed significantly since AS Police heydays. Academy football has a tremendous impact on football in Senegal both locally and in the national teams. Jeanne D'Arc is an old club that even precedes AS Police in terms of success and notoriety. However, teams like Diambarrs and Guediawaye FC have become notable forces because of academy pathways.
